For … WebApr 1, 2009 · The management of diabetic foot ulcers includes several facets of care. Offloading and debridement are considered vital to the healing process for diabetic foot wounds. 23 The goal of offloading is to redistribute force from ulcers sites and pressure points at risk to a wider area of contact. There are multiple methods of pressure relief ...
